Club History


Continental FC History

Continental Football Club is a predominantly black team, which was founded in 1958 and makes us one of, if not the oldest black club in Britain. During this time we have won virtually every trophy we entered in, including the London Senior Cup three times. We have been runners up in the Middlesex County Senior Cup and reached the quarterfinals of the prestigious FA Sunday National Cup, which was an achievement in itself considering the lack of resources.

We were considered one of the best black teams in Southern England during the mid to late ‘80s, as most of the players played semi–professional. Most of the original players have now retired and the team has gone through a transition period whereby we have introduced a blend of experience and youth in the side and are still winning trophies in major cup competitions.

During our illustrious history we have paved the way for many black youngsters to move onto semi professional and professional clubs and still have players who can influence these decisions for players to progress to that higher level.

We believe that the experience and knowledge of the senior players is helping youngster’s progress in the sport and also helping with their focus on life in general.
